It took a while but now it finally happened: The Romanian Government approved the Green Certificates Scheme that pays up to 6 Green Certificates for Renewable Energy Project in Romania. But for now it is the Wind Energy that seems to trigger investors. Although with over 8000 MW already with a connection contract the market fights for the last available projects. Wind pays up to 160 EURO per MW until 2018 and with electricity prices expected to double in the next decade, Wind looks like a good investment.
How to find good projects?
Yet, it is not so easy to find good projects in Romania. The reason is that many projects are developed in the so-called NATURA 2000 protected area's. That means that although authorities might have issued an environment permit, the project might be forced to close down when contested in the European Court. This is because of the EU Birds Directive and Habitat Directive. Projects in Germany, Poland and Bulgaria already has to stop operations because of an EU court Order.
